A fast food restaurant, also identified as a quick service restaurant (QSR) in the enterprise, is a particular type of eatery that serves fast food cookery and has minimum table setting. The food served in fast food eateries is typically composed of a "meat-sweet diet", awarded from a short menu, prepared in bulk in advance and kept warm, perfected and packaged to request, and normally available for carrying away, though accommodation may be given. Fast food eateries are typically part of an eatery chain or franchise service that gives patterned ingredients also partially cooked foods and supplies to each eatery through controlled quantity ways.
